尾数位全为1,则最大数为1.11111111111111111111111*2^127=(2-2^-23)*2^127=3.4028234663852886*10^38 则十六进制表示为:0x7f7f ffff 3.测试代码: voidmain(intargc,char* argv[])
12-20 299
大学c语言知识点总结 |
c语言保留小数点后几位怎么弄,c语言两位小数四舍五入输出六位
当setprecision(n)和fixed一起使用时,您可以控制小数位数。 只需添加以下任何语句即可。 cout< 1要输出floata=1.23234;要保留3位小数,写法为:printf("%.3f",a);2要输出doubleb=123.345232;要保留4位小数,写法为:printf("%.4lf",b);以上是关于C语言中如何保留两位小数。C语言中如何保留两位小数可以限制数量输出期间的小数点。 输出单精度浮点浮点变量f时,可以使用printf("%.2f",f);使输出结果保留两位有效数字。 其中,.2表示保留两个 使用float函数,语法格式为:float('%.[num]f'%[data]),其中data为数据,num为小数点后保留的位数。使用Decimal类,语法格式为:Decimal([data]).quantize(Decimal('0.00')),其中data优先,可以使用round() C语言提供的函数实现保留小数点后六位数字的功能。 其次,你可以使用printf( C语言保留指定的小数位数。在嵌入式开发中,我们经常会遇到C语言需要保留指定的小数位数的问题。我在这里记录一下,以免每次使用时都需要处理。 有两种方法:方法一,printf为例,录取总成绩(保留两位小数)=换算的初试成绩(满分100分)×50%+复试成绩(满分100分)×50%。其中:换算的初试成绩=(初试总成绩/初试总成绩(满分)核心)×100点5.BUFF团队视角
后台-插件-广告管理-内容页尾部广告(手机)
标签: c语言两位小数四舍五入输出六位
相关文章
尾数位全为1,则最大数为1.11111111111111111111111*2^127=(2-2^-23)*2^127=3.4028234663852886*10^38 则十六进制表示为:0x7f7f ffff 3.测试代码: voidmain(intargc,char* argv[])
12-20 299
说明:%6.2f 表明待打印的数(floatNum)至少占6个字符宽度(包括两位小数和一个小数点),且小数点后面有2位小数,小数点占一位,所以整数部分至少占3位。 注意:这里的6是待打印的数至少占...
12-20 299
1 设置一: 有时候移动设备使用后会出现鼠标左键单击变双击的情况,这时可以打开任务管理器,并结束进程中的“wowexec.exe”和“cdilla10.exe”两项,这样就会恢复正常,但下次使...
12-20 299
一:系统繁忙,不能响应你的系统安装太久,或软件安装太多,注册表过大垃圾太多;或者很久没有做磁盘整理;或者安了多个附加右键菜单的软件;或者杀毒软件设置过于保守,解决办法可以尝...
12-20 299
发表评论
评论列表